The marital privilege does not end when the spouses separate with the intent to permanently end their marriage. In the following case, a judge compelled one spouse (a wife) to testify against her husband about past physical abuse he committed of her, although at the time of trial they were still legally married. On appeal, the appellate court found this was erroneous, but it was a harmless error, so the verdict was not reversed.
